    Maestro Fuzztain clone

    I make a decal using white decal paper and design the printout with photoshop, then print it on a laser printer, cut it out with an exacto #11 blade on a cutting mat, then apply it to an enclosure that has it's face sanded with a Bosch orbital sander using 220 grit. I use micro-set to set the...

    Third Build Today-Ampeg Scrambler

    it's a clear waterslide decal printed on a laser printer. I cut them out and apply them to a sanded enclosure with micro set and then shoot multiple coast of Krylon matte clear. then i wet sand it with 1000 grit and buff it on a large floor standing buffer with menzerna compond until it a high...
